?? index.htm
字號(hào):
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312">
<title>Thinking in Java Chinese Version | Start Page</title>
<meta name="Microsoft Theme" content="inmotion 111, default"></head>
<body background="_themes/inmotion/inmtextb.gif" tppabs="http://member.netease.com/%7etransbot/Thinking%20in%20Java/_themes/inmotion/inmtextb.gif" bgcolor="#FFFFCC" text="#000000" link="#800000" vlink="#996633" alink="#FF3399">
<p align="center"><strong><big><big>《Thinking In Java》中文版</big></big></strong></p>
<p align="center">--免費(fèi)電子書,僅供網(wǎng)上參考,不得私自出版!</p>
<!--msthemelist--><table border="0" cellpadding="0" cellspacing="0" width="100%">
<!--msthemelist--><tr><td valign="baseline" width="42"><img src="_themes/inmotion/inmbul1a.gif" tppabs="http://member.netease.com/%7etransbot/Thinking%20in%20Java/_themes/inmotion/inmbul1a.gif" width="20" height="20" hspace="11"></td><td valign="top" width="100%">作者:<a href="mailto:Bruce@EckelObjects.com">Bruce Eckel</a><br>
主頁(yè):<a href="../../../tppmsgs/msgs0.htm#1" tppabs="http://www.bruceeckel.com/">http://www.BruceEckel.com</a><!--msthemelist--></td></tr>
<!--msthemelist--><tr><td valign="baseline" width="42"><img src="_themes/inmotion/inmbul1a.gif" tppabs="http://member.netease.com/%7etransbot/Thinking%20in%20Java/_themes/inmotion/inmbul1a.gif" width="20" height="20" hspace="11"></td><td valign="top" width="100%">編譯:<a href="mailto:transbot@netease.com">Trans Bot</a><br>
主頁(yè):<a href="../../../tppmsgs/msgs0.htm#2" tppabs="http://member.netease.com/%7etransbot">http://member.netease.com/~transbot</a><!--msthemelist--></td></tr>
<!--msthemelist--></table>
<p><strong>致謝</strong></p>
<p align="right">--獻(xiàn)給那些直到現(xiàn)在仍在孜孜不倦創(chuàng)造下一代計(jì)算機(jī)語(yǔ)言的人們!
</p>
<!--msthemeseparator--><p align="center"><img src="_themes/inmotion/inmhorsa.gif" tppabs="http://member.netease.com/%7etransbot/Thinking%20in%20Java/_themes/inmotion/inmhorsa.gif" width="300" height="10"></p>
<p align="center"><a href="../../../tppmsgs/msgs0.htm#1" tppabs="http://www.bruceeckel.com/">英文版主頁(yè)</a> | <a href="index.htm" tppabs="http://member.netease.com/%7etransbot/Thinking%20in%20Java/index.htm">中文版主頁(yè)</a> | <a href="contents/index.htm" tppabs="http://member.netease.com/%7etransbot/Thinking%20in%20Java/contents/index.htm">詳細(xì)目錄</a> | <a href="about/index.htm" tppabs="http://member.netease.com/%7etransbot/Thinking%20in%20Java/about/index.htm">關(guān)于譯者</a></p>
<!--msthemelist--><table border="0" cellpadding="0" cellspacing="0" width="100%">
<!--msthemelist--><tr><td valign="baseline" width="42"><img src="_themes/inmotion/inmbul1a.gif" tppabs="http://member.netease.com/%7etransbot/Thinking%20in%20Java/_themes/inmotion/inmbul1a.gif" width="20" height="20" hspace="11"></td><td valign="top" width="100%">指導(dǎo)您利用萬(wàn)維網(wǎng)的語(yǔ)言進(jìn)行面向?qū)ο蟮某绦蛟O(shè)計(jì)<!--msthemelist--></td></tr>
<!--msthemelist--><tr><td valign="baseline" width="42"><img src="_themes/inmotion/inmbul1a.gif" tppabs="http://member.netease.com/%7etransbot/Thinking%20in%20Java/_themes/inmotion/inmbul1a.gif" width="20" height="20" hspace="11"></td><td valign="top" width="100%">完整的正文、更新內(nèi)容及程序代碼可從<a href="../../../tppmsgs/msgs0.htm#1" tppabs="http://www.bruceeckel.com/">http://www.bruceeckel.com</a>下載<!--msthemelist--></td></tr>
<!--msthemelist--></table>
<p>從Java的基本語(yǔ)法到它最高級(jí)的特性(網(wǎng)絡(luò)編程、高級(jí)面向?qū)ο竽芰Α⒍嗑€程),《Thinking
In Java》都能對(duì)您有所裨益。Bruce Eckel優(yōu)美的行文以及短小、精悍的程序示例有助于您理解含義模糊的概念。
</p>
<!--msthemelist--><table border="0" cellpadding="0" cellspacing="0" width="100%">
<!--msthemelist--><tr><td valign="baseline" width="42"><img src="_themes/inmotion/inmbul1a.gif" tppabs="http://member.netease.com/%7etransbot/Thinking%20in%20Java/_themes/inmotion/inmbul1a.gif" width="20" height="20" hspace="11"></td><td valign="top" width="100%">面向初學(xué)者和某種程度的專家<!--msthemelist--></td></tr>
<!--msthemelist--><tr><td valign="baseline" width="42"><img src="_themes/inmotion/inmbul1a.gif" tppabs="http://member.netease.com/%7etransbot/Thinking%20in%20Java/_themes/inmotion/inmbul1a.gif" width="20" height="20" hspace="11"></td><td valign="top" width="100%">教授Java語(yǔ)言,而不是與平臺(tái)有關(guān)的理論<!--msthemelist--></td></tr>
<!--msthemelist--><tr><td valign="baseline" width="42"><img src="_themes/inmotion/inmbul1a.gif" tppabs="http://member.netease.com/%7etransbot/Thinking%20in%20Java/_themes/inmotion/inmbul1a.gif" width="20" height="20" hspace="11"></td><td valign="top" width="100%">覆蓋Java 1.2的大多數(shù)重要方面:Swing和新集合<!--msthemelist--></td></tr>
<!--msthemelist--><tr><td valign="baseline" width="42"><img src="_themes/inmotion/inmbul1a.gif" tppabs="http://member.netease.com/%7etransbot/Thinking%20in%20Java/_themes/inmotion/inmbul1a.gif" width="20" height="20" hspace="11"></td><td valign="top" width="100%">系統(tǒng)講述Java的高級(jí)理論:網(wǎng)絡(luò)編程、多線程處理、虛擬機(jī)性能以及同非Java代碼的連接<!--msthemelist--></td></tr>
<!--msthemelist--><tr><td valign="baseline" width="42"><img src="_themes/inmotion/inmbul1a.gif" tppabs="http://member.netease.com/%7etransbot/Thinking%20in%20Java/_themes/inmotion/inmbul1a.gif" width="20" height="20" hspace="11"></td><td valign="top" width="100%">320個(gè)有用的Java程序,15000行以上代碼<!--msthemelist--></td></tr>
<!--msthemelist--><tr><td valign="baseline" width="42"><img src="_themes/inmotion/inmbul1a.gif" tppabs="http://member.netease.com/%7etransbot/Thinking%20in%20Java/_themes/inmotion/inmbul1a.gif" width="20" height="20" hspace="11"></td><td valign="top" width="100%">解釋面向?qū)ο蠡纠碚摚瑥睦^承到設(shè)計(jì)方案<!--msthemelist--></td></tr>
<!--msthemelist--><tr><td valign="baseline" width="42"><img src="_themes/inmotion/inmbul1a.gif" tppabs="http://member.netease.com/%7etransbot/Thinking%20in%20Java/_themes/inmotion/inmbul1a.gif" width="20" height="20" hspace="11"></td><td valign="top" width="100%">來(lái)自與眾不同的獲獎(jiǎng)作者Bruce Eckel<!--msthemelist--></td></tr>
<!--msthemelist--><tr><td valign="baseline" width="42"><img src="_themes/inmotion/inmbul1a.gif" tppabs="http://member.netease.com/%7etransbot/Thinking%20in%20Java/_themes/inmotion/inmbul1a.gif" width="20" height="20" hspace="11"></td><td valign="top" width="100%">可通過(guò)萬(wàn)維網(wǎng)免費(fèi)索取源碼和持續(xù)更新的本書電子版<!--msthemelist--></td></tr>
<!--msthemelist--><tr><td valign="baseline" width="42"><img src="_themes/inmotion/inmbul1a.gif" tppabs="http://member.netease.com/%7etransbot/Thinking%20in%20Java/_themes/inmotion/inmbul1a.gif" width="20" height="20" hspace="11"></td><td valign="top" width="100%">從www.BruceEckel.com獲得配套CD(含15小時(shí)以上的合成語(yǔ)音授課)<!--msthemelist--></td></tr>
<!--msthemelist--></table>
<p>讀者如是說(shuō):“最好的Java參考書……絕對(duì)讓人震驚”;“購(gòu)買Java參考書最明智的選擇”;“我見(jiàn)過(guò)的最棒的編程指南”。<br>
<br>
Bruce Eckel也是《Thinking in C++》的作者,該書曾獲1995年SoftwareDevelopment
Jolt Award最佳書籍大獎(jiǎng)。作為一名有20經(jīng)驗(yàn)的編程專家,曾教授過(guò)世界上許多地區(qū)的人進(jìn)行對(duì)象編程。最開始涉及的領(lǐng)域是C++,現(xiàn)在也進(jìn)軍Java。他是C++標(biāo)準(zhǔn)協(xié)會(huì)有表決權(quán)的成員之一,曾就面向?qū)ο蟪绦蛟O(shè)計(jì)這一主題寫過(guò)其他5本書,發(fā)表過(guò)150多篇文章,并是多家計(jì)算機(jī)雜志的專欄作家,其中包括《Web
Techniques》的Java專欄。曾出席過(guò)C++和Java的“軟件開發(fā)者會(huì)議”,并分獲“應(yīng)用物理”與“計(jì)算機(jī)工程”的學(xué)士和碩士學(xué)位。<br>
<br>
<strong>讀者的心聲</strong> </p>
<dl>
<dd>比我看過(guò)的Java書好多了……非常全面,舉例都恰到好處,顯得頗具“智慧”。和其他許多Java書籍相比,我覺(jué)得它更成熟、連貫、更有說(shuō)服力、更嚴(yán)謹(jǐn)。總之,寫得非常好,肯定是一本學(xué)習(xí)Java的好書。(Anatoly
Vorobey,TechnionUniversity,Haifa,以色列)。<br>
<br>
是我見(jiàn)過(guò)的最好的編程指南,對(duì)任何語(yǔ)言都不外如是。(Joakim ziegler,F(xiàn)IX系統(tǒng)管理員)<br>
<br>
感謝你寫出如此優(yōu)秀的一本Java參考書。(Dr. Gavin Pillay,Registrar,King
Edward VII Hospital,南非)<br>
<br>
再次感謝您這本令人震驚的書。我以前真的有點(diǎn)兒不知所從的感覺(jué)(因?yàn)椴皇荂程序員),但你的書淺顯易懂,使我能很快掌握J(rèn)ava——差不多就是閱讀的速度吧。能從頭掌握基本原理和概念的感覺(jué)真好,再也不用通過(guò)不斷的試驗(yàn)和出錯(cuò)來(lái)建立概念模型了。希望不久能有機(jī)會(huì)參加您的講座。(Randall
R. Hawley,Automation Technician,Eli Lilly & Co)<br>
<br>
我迄今為止看過(guò)的最好的計(jì)算機(jī)參考書。(Tom Holland)<br>
<br>
這是我讀過(guò)的關(guān)于程序設(shè)計(jì)的最好的一本書……第16章有關(guān)設(shè)計(jì)方案的內(nèi)容是我這么久以來(lái)看過(guò)的最有價(jià)值的。(Han
Finci,助教,計(jì)算機(jī)科學(xué)學(xué)院,耶路撒冷希伯來(lái)大學(xué),以色列)<br>
<br>
有史以來(lái)最好的一本Java參考書。(Ravindra Pai,Oracle公司SUNOS產(chǎn)品線)<br>
<br>
這是關(guān)于Java的一本好書。非常不錯(cuò),你干得太好了!書中涉及的深度真讓人震驚。一旦正式出版,我肯定會(huì)買下它。我從96年十月就開始學(xué)習(xí)Java了。通過(guò)比較幾本書,你的書可以納入“必讀”之列。這幾個(gè)月來(lái),我一直在搞一個(gè)完全用Java寫的產(chǎn)品。你的書鞏固了我一些薄弱的地方,并大大延伸了我已知的東西。甚至在會(huì)見(jiàn)承包商的時(shí)候,我都引用了書中的一些解釋,它對(duì)我們的開發(fā)小組太有用了。通過(guò)詢問(wèn)組內(nèi)成員我從書中學(xué)來(lái)的知識(shí)(比如數(shù)組和矢量的區(qū)別),可以判斷他們對(duì)Java的掌握有多深。(Steve
Wilkinson,MCI通信公司資深專家)<br>
<br>
好書!我見(jiàn)過(guò)的最好的一本Java教材。(Jeff Sinclair,軟件工程師,Kestral
Computing公司)<br>
<br>
感謝你的《Thinking in Java》。終于有人能突破傳統(tǒng)的計(jì)算機(jī)參考書模式,進(jìn)入一個(gè)更全面、更深入的境界。我讀過(guò)許多書,只有你的和Patrick
Winston的書才在我心目中占據(jù)了一個(gè)位置。我已向客戶鄭重推薦這本書。再次感謝。(Richard
Brooks,Java顧問(wèn),Sun專業(yè)服務(wù)公司,達(dá)拉斯市)<br>
<br>
其他書討論的都是Java“是什么”(講述語(yǔ)法和庫(kù)),或者Java“怎樣用”(編程實(shí)例)。《Thinking
in Java》顯然與眾不同,是我所知唯一一本解釋Java“為什么”的書:為什么象這樣設(shè)計(jì),為什么象這樣工作,為什么有時(shí)不能工作,為什么比C++好,為什么沒(méi)有C++好,等等。盡管這本書也很好講述了“是什么”和“怎樣用”的問(wèn)題,但它的特色并在于此。這本書特別適合那些想追根溯源的人。(Robert
S. Stephenson)<br>
<br>
感謝您寫出這么一本優(yōu)秀的書,我對(duì)它越來(lái)越愛(ài)不釋手。我的學(xué)生也喜歡它。(Chuck
Iverson)<br>
<br>
向你在《Thinking in Java》的工作致敬。這本書對(duì)因特網(wǎng)的未來(lái)進(jìn)行了最恰當(dāng)?shù)慕沂荆抑皇窍雽?duì)你說(shuō)聲“謝謝”,它非常有價(jià)值。(Patrick
Barrell,Network Officer Mamco-QAF Mfg公司)<br>
<br>
市面上大多數(shù)Java書作為新手指南都是不錯(cuò)的。但它們的立意大多雷同,舉的例子也有過(guò)多的重復(fù)。從未沒(méi)見(jiàn)過(guò)象您這樣的一本書,它和那些書完全是兩碼事。我認(rèn)為它是迄今為止最好的一本參考書。請(qǐng)快些出版它!……另外,由于《Thinking
in Java》都這么好了,我也趕快去買了一本《Thinking in C++》。(George
Laframboise,LightWorx技術(shù)咨詢公司)<br>
<br>
從前給你寫過(guò)信,主要是表達(dá)對(duì)《Thinking in C++》一書的驚嘆(那本書在我的書架上占有突出的位置)。今天,我很欣慰地看到你投向了Java領(lǐng)域,并有幸拜讀了最新的《Thinking
in Java》電子版。看過(guò)之后,我不得不說(shuō):“服了!”內(nèi)容非常精彩,有很強(qiáng)的說(shuō)服力,不象讀那些干巴巴的參考書。你講到了Java開發(fā)最重要、也最易忽略的方面:基本原理。(Sean
Brady)<br>
<br>
你舉的例子都非常淺顯,很容易理解。Java的許多重要細(xì)節(jié)都照顧到了,而單薄的Java文檔根本沒(méi)有涉及那些方面。另外,這本書沒(méi)有浪費(fèi)讀者的時(shí)間。程序員已經(jīng)知道了一些基本的事實(shí),你在這個(gè)基礎(chǔ)上進(jìn)行了很好的發(fā)揮。(Kai
Engert,Innovative Software公司,德國(guó))<br>
<br>
我是您的《Thinking in C++》的忠實(shí)讀者。通讀了您的Java書的電子版以后,發(fā)現(xiàn)您在這兩本書上有同樣高級(jí)別的寫作水平。謝謝!(Peter
R. Neuwald)<br>
<br>
寫得非常好的一本Java書……我認(rèn)為您的工作簡(jiǎn)直可以說(shuō)“偉大”。我是芝加哥地區(qū)Java特別興趣組的頭兒,已在最近的幾次聚會(huì)上推薦了您的書和Web站點(diǎn)。以后每個(gè)月開SIG會(huì)的時(shí)候,我都想把《Thinking
in Java》作為基本的指導(dǎo)教材使用。一般來(lái)說(shuō),我們會(huì)每次討論書中的一章內(nèi)容。(Mark
Ertes)<br>
<br>
衷心感謝你的書,它寫得太好了。我已把它推薦給自己的用戶和Ph.D.學(xué)生。(Hugues
Leroy//Irisa-Inria Rennes France,Head of Scientific Computingand Industrial Tranfert)<br>
<br>
我到現(xiàn)在只讀了《Thinking in Java》的40頁(yè)內(nèi)容,但已對(duì)它留下了深刻的印象。這無(wú)疑是見(jiàn)過(guò)的最精彩的編程專業(yè)書……而且我本身就是一個(gè)作家,所以這點(diǎn)兒看法還是有些權(quán)威吧。我已訂購(gòu)了《Thinking
in C++》,已經(jīng)等得迫不及待了——我是一名編程新手,最怕的就是散亂無(wú)章的學(xué)習(xí)線索。所以必須在這里向您的出色工作表示敬意。以前看過(guò)的書似乎都有這方面的毛病,經(jīng)常使我才提起的興致消彌于無(wú)形。但看了你的書以后,感覺(jué)好多了。(Glenn
Becker,EducationalTheatre Association)<br>
<br>
謝謝您這本出色的書。在終于認(rèn)識(shí)了Java與C++之間糾纏不清的一些事實(shí)后,我真的要非常感謝這本書。對(duì)您的書非常滿意!(Felix
Bizaoui,Twin OaksIndustries,Louisa,Va)<br>
<br>
恭喜你寫出這么好的一本書。我是在有了閱讀《Thinking in C++》的經(jīng)歷以后,才來(lái)看這本《Thinking
in Java》的,它確實(shí)沒(méi)讓我失望。(Jaco van derMerwe,軟件專家,DataFusion
Systems有限公司,Stellenbosch,南非)<br>
?? 快捷鍵說(shuō)明
復(fù)制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號(hào)
Ctrl + =
減小字號(hào)
Ctrl + -